Volvo’s Vanguard acquires Advantage Truck Centers

Nov. 29, 2021
The acquisition expands Vanguard Truck Center's footprint to 23 locations, adding three Volvo locations—including sales and service operations—in Charlotte, Greensboro, and Hickory, North Carolina.

Vanguard Truck Centers, a multi-regional, full-service commercial truck dealer group and leasing operation of Volvo Trucks North America (VTNA), has acquired Charlotte-based Advantage Truck Centers and Advantage Truck Leasing.

The acquisition of Advantage expands Vanguard’s authorized Volvo Trucks dealership footprint from 20 to 23 locations, adding three Volvo locations in North Carolina, including sales and service operations in Charlotte, Greensboro and Hickory. The expanded group now has about 900 employees, a total of 360 Volvo Trucks service bays, and an extensive parts inventory.

“The addition of Advantage Truck Centers strengthens Vanguard’s position as one of the largest Volvo Trucks dealer groups in North America and one of the largest dealer-owned leasing companies,” said Peter Voorhoeve, president at VTNA. “Vanguard and Advantage have been outstanding ambassadors of the Volvo Trucks brand, proven by more than 25 years of dedication to performance, safety, service and improving our customers’ ownership experiences.”

Vanguard was founded in 1989, acquiring its first Volvo Trucks dealership in Atlanta in 1994.

“We are proud to welcome Advantage Truck Centers and Advantage Truck Leasing to the Vanguard family,” said Tom Ewing, president and CEO of Vanguard Truck Centers. “I have tremendous admiration for what Advantage has accomplished in North Carolina, and Vanguard will continue to build on that standard of excellence by providing best-in-class trucks, parts, service, and leasing for our customers.”
